Kaplan-Meier survival analysis developer

A Kaplan-Meier survival analysis developer creates statistical models to estimate the survival distribution of a population, often in medical research. They use the Kaplan-Meier method to calculate probabilities of survival over time, considering factors such as participants dropping out or events not occurring during observation. This analysis provides insights into the effectiveness of treatments or interventions. The developer's role involves data collection, cleaning, and analysis, ensuring correct application of the Kaplan-Meier technique, and interpreting and communicating results. They also manage confounding variables, handle missing data, and maintain statistical software and coding.

Kaplan-Meier survival analysis developer

Hiring a Kaplan-Meier Survival Analysis developer offers several advantages. Firstly, they provide insights into survival data, which is essential in industries like healthcare, engineering, and market research. By understanding the time it takes for an event to occur, businesses can make informed decisions.

Secondly, these developers are skilled in handling censored data. In survival analysis, some events of interest may not be observed within the study period, leading to censored data. A Kaplan-Meier developer can effectively manage and analyze this, ensuring valuable information isn’t discarded.

Thirdly, they can help in risk prediction. With their understanding of survival probabilities at different time points, they can predict future risks, enabling proactive measures.

Fourthly, they provide a visual representation of survival data. They can create a Kaplan-Meier curve, which is a graphical representation of survival probabilities over time, making the data easier to understand.

Lastly, they bring statistical expertise. A Kaplan-Meier developer understands the assumptions and limitations of survival analysis, ensuring accurate interpretation of results. They can also perform complex statistical tests like the log-rank test for comparing survival curves.
